+#define BYTES_ZERO_BEFORE_END (1<<12)
+
+/* There used to be a similar function called SCRUB-CONTROL-STACK in
+ * Lisp and another called zero_stack() in cheneygc.c, but since it's
+ * shorter to express in, and more often called from C, I keep only
+ * the C one after fixing it. -- MG 2009-03-25 */
+
+/* Zero the unused portion of the control stack so that old objects
+ * are not kept alive because of uninitialized stack variables.
+ *
+ * "To summarize the problem, since not all allocated stack frame
+ * slots are guaranteed to be written by the time you call an another
+ * function or GC, there may be garbage pointers retained in your dead
+ * stack locations. The stack scrubbing only affects the part of the
+ * stack from the SP to the end of the allocated stack." - ram, on
+ * cmucl-imp, Tue, 25 Sep 2001
+ *
+ * So, as an (admittedly lame) workaround, from time to time we call
+ * scrub-control-stack to zero out all the unused portion. This is
+ * supposed to happen when the stack is mostly empty, so that we have
+ * a chance of clearing more of it: callers are currently (2002.07.18)
+ * REPL, SUB-GC and sig_stop_for_gc_handler. */
+
+/* Take care not to tread on the guard page and the hard guard page as
+ * it would be unkind to sig_stop_for_gc_handler. Touching the return
+ * guard page is not dangerous. For this to work the guard page must
+ * be zeroed when protected. */
+
+/* FIXME: I think there is no guarantee that once
+ * BYTES_ZERO_BEFORE_END bytes are zero the rest are also zero. This
+ * may be what the "lame" adjective in the above comment is for. In
+ * this case, exact gc may lose badly. */
+void
+scrub_control_stack(void)
+{
+ struct thread *th = arch_os_get_current_thread();
+ os_vm_address_t guard_page_address = CONTROL_STACK_GUARD_PAGE(th);
+ os_vm_address_t hard_guard_page_address = CONTROL_STACK_HARD_GUARD_PAGE(th);
+ lispobj *sp;
+#ifdef LISP_FEATURE_C_STACK_IS_CONTROL_STACK
+ sp = (lispobj *)&sp - 1;
+#else
+ sp = current_control_stack_pointer;
+#endif
+ scrub:
+ if ((((os_vm_address_t)sp < (hard_guard_page_address + os_vm_page_size)) &&
+ ((os_vm_address_t)sp >= hard_guard_page_address)) ||
+ (((os_vm_address_t)sp < (guard_page_address + os_vm_page_size)) &&
+ ((os_vm_address_t)sp >= guard_page_address) &&
+ (th->control_stack_guard_page_protected != NIL)))
+ return;
+#ifdef LISP_FEATURE_STACK_GROWS_DOWNWARD_NOT_UPWARD
+ do {
+ *sp = 0;
+ } while (((unsigned long)sp--) & (BYTES_ZERO_BEFORE_END - 1));
+ if ((os_vm_address_t)sp < (hard_guard_page_address + os_vm_page_size))
+ return;
+ do {
+ if (*sp)
+ goto scrub;
+ } while (((unsigned long)sp--) & (BYTES_ZERO_BEFORE_END - 1));
+#else
+ do {
+ *sp = 0;
+ } while (((unsigned long)++sp) & (BYTES_ZERO_BEFORE_END - 1));
+ if ((os_vm_address_t)sp >= hard_guard_page_address)
+ return;
+ do {
+ if (*sp)
+ goto scrub;
+ } while (((unsigned long)++sp) & (BYTES_ZERO_BEFORE_END - 1));
+#endif
+}
